The 3 months correlation between Nu Holdings and UBS is 0.51.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Nu Holdings and UBS Group AG in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on UBS Group AG and Nu Holdings is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Nu Holdings are associated (or correlated) with UBS Group.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of UBS Group AG has no effect on the direction of Nu Holdings i.e., Nu Holdings and UBS Group go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Nu Holdings and UBS Group
The main advantage of trading using opposite Nu Holdings and UBS Group posit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Nu Holdings position performs unexpectedly, UBS Group can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
